  • Spatially Resolved Spectral Energy Distributions of Nearby Galaxies
    We present azimuthally-averaged spectral energy distributions (SEDs) from FUV to FIR, as a function of radius, for the galaxies included in the SINGS sample. The radial changes in these SEDs are interpreted in terms of variations of the relative contribution of stars (of different ages), dust and gas.
